A CAR caught fire at York's Clifton Moor Retail Park this morning (May 4).

North Yorkshire Fire and Rescue crews were called to the scene at about 11.40am.

It involved a Citroen car and happened in the car park near the Sofology store.

A spokeswoman for the fire service said: "The driver was driving the vehicle when it set on fire and they pulled up and quickly jumped out."

She confirmed that nobody was injured.

The crews used a hose reel, breathing apparatus and small tools to deal with the fire.

An eyewitnesss said there was thick black smoke and flames coming from the car.
